Output e88299940a48bb963128a6a35226f2c5043473af2d46edf9528761fca6020647:0

value
1322
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d4102ae657a52039f837971fcd488bf6fb3dda23f6dd8a34a3e939f68645e23
address
bc1pe4qs9tn90ffq88ur09cle4yghahm8hdz8aka3g6286fe76rytc3s5lsk7y
transaction
e88299940a48bb963128a6a35226f2c5043473af2d46edf9528761fca6020647
confirmations
40149
spent
true